我申请这个blog是为了督促自己,把自己平时的一些想法和思考结果保留下来。 本博客所有内容均为原创,如有转载请注明作者和出处

ORA-600(qmxiUnpPacked2)错误

上一篇 / 下一篇  2008-05-13 21:06:30 / 个人分类:Bug

从一个数据库的alert文件中发现了这个错误,应该是数据库升级过程留下的,简单记录一下错误信息。

 

 

从数据库的alert文件中发现的错误信息为:

Sun Aug  8 09:36:38 2004ITPUB个人空间 A*m3J;HmC
alter database rename global_name to repdb01ITPUB个人空间)XT?8ym\4R
Completed: alter database rename global_name to repdb01
s!?kS{0aNS0Sun Aug  8 09:36:39 2004
k\s Kea}0ALTER TABLESPACE TEMP ADD TEMPFILE '/u1/oracle/oradata/repdb01/temp01.dbf' REUSE AUTOEXTEND ON NEXT 640K MAXSIZE UNLIMITEDITPUB个人空间"a vN2M/im R(^#~7o
Completed: ALTER TABLESPACE TEMP ADD TEMPFILE '/u1/oracle/ora
b!PEa2C?o0Sun Aug  8 09:36:40 2004
e ^ X{T(ml'x0alter database character set INTERNAL_CONVERT ZHS16GBK
'} H9}5p\l/f5p/r V;O0Updating character set in controlfile to ZHS16GBK
*q~p!sJ0 SYS.SNAP$ (REL_QUERY) - CLOB representation altered
Y:E^n Th7``-im0 SYS.METASTYLESHEET (STYLESHEET) - CLOB representation altered
C+Pt qPRE2yw0 SYS.EXTERNAL_TAB$ (PARAM_CLOB) - CLOB representation alteredITPUB个人空间`V d1RW;|
 XDB.XDB$RESOURCE (SYS_NC00027$) - CLOB representation alteredITPUB个人空间)S;{$R1t_
 ODM.ODM_PMML_DTD (DTD) - CLOB representation alteredITPUB个人空间s\,\v$PI m
 OE.WAREHOUSES (SYS_NC00003$) - CLOB representation alteredITPUB个人空间r!z3T$w;?y0Bqs
 PM.ONLINE_MEDIA (SYS_NC00042$) - CLOB representation alteredITPUB个人空间0FA9_c"O/A.u S
 PM.ONLINE_MEDIA (SYS_NC00062$) - CLOB representation alteredITPUB个人空间gH^z1[z
 PM.ONLINE_MEDIA (PRODUCT_TEXT) - CLOB representation altered
de%@(S/TAF0 PM.ONLINE_MEDIA (SYS_NC00080$) - CLOB representation alteredITPUB个人空间 p2^ yh4P'Fe;M&`
 PM.PRINT_MEDIA (AD_SOURCETEXT) - CLOB representation alteredITPUB个人空间8RC8Nc#j(f!b8CS3s
 PM.PRINT_MEDIA (AD_FINALTEXT) - CLOB representation alteredITPUB个人空间oQXA.k Ai*y-_
Completed: alter database character set INTERNAL_CONVERT ZHS1ITPUB个人空间zYa#eYl/f
Sun Aug  8 09:37:08 2004ITPUB个人空间 u0T}k a1RZ.V+^
alter database national character set INTERNAL_CONVERT AL16UTF16
4~$[{[k!U0Completed: alter database national character set INTERNAL_CON
K-m*U8]0{0Sun Aug  8 09:40:36 2004ITPUB个人空间2TfG(ln1u
Errors in file /u1/oracle/admin/repdb01/udump/repdb01_ora_558.trc:ITPUB个人空间 IJ;ha"zdh
ORA-00600: internal error code, arguments: [qmxiUnpPacked2], [121], [], [], [], [], [], []ITPUB个人空间&G@4@%}tF"{,Z
Shutting down instance: further logons disabled
jy5k!h~f0Shutting down instance (normal)ITPUB个人空间ir9x`vR R
License high water mark = 1ITPUB个人空间n/|;_;EW2D u
Waiting for dispatcher 'D000' to shutdownITPUB个人空间@`O[([#? ~}Tp+Z
All dispatchers and shared servers shutdown
5M&L9w2F]HdK0Sun Aug  8 09:40:45 2004
dLg\W!c `(c0ALTER DATABASE CLOSE NORMAL
\7k}QW~0Sun Aug  8 09:40:45 2004ITPUB个人空间B;P,a1H@u'HBjv
SMON: disabling tx recoveryITPUB个人空间_J*Xy)g+i#q-~ |
SMON: disabling cache recoveryITPUB个人空间ll mi:Ur `e
Sun Aug  8 09:40:45 2004ITPUB个人空间"h1K?$X^.LU py D
Shutting down archive processes
^/Wa.kl{)xr.H9o}0Archiving is disabledITPUB个人空间wNb&hp%[3[
Archive process shutdown avoided: 0 activeITPUB个人空间I(S]*pxS
Thread 1 closed at log sequence 1ITPUB个人空间^7v}_ h6\A$p0WJ
Successful close of redo thread 1.ITPUB个人空间a@.YK3u q f
Sun Aug  8 09:40:45 2004ITPUB个人空间1JOO r6s/C9my/c
Completed: ALTER DATABASE CLOSE NORMALITPUB个人空间pR,E3~!G&s!j-N
Sun Aug  8 09:40:45 2004
F ]5qDMb#e8B]0ALTER DATABASE DISMOUNTITPUB个人空间Y:V-Y8Uja!Z7N
Completed: ALTER DATABASE DISMOUNTITPUB个人空间yrB)}^2O;tQ ]
ARCH: Archiving is disabled
Bg9S.MAS:~R0Shutting down archive processesITPUB个人空间0b/GOG E2faDw
Archiving is disabledITPUB个人空间Y6^fb|*a&f K k8IeD
Archive process shutdown avoided: 0 activeITPUB个人空间3t;o6j$wH
ARCH: Archiving is disabled
FdXu#Z0Shutting down archive processes
UU/ri&_ }*}3k\%ce0Archiving is disabledITPUB个人空间A;e)h"{z&?"r
Archive process shutdown avoided: 0 active
[0x m@dL|Wf0Sun Aug  8 09:40:49 2004ITPUB个人空间p*W;{&z nk
Starting ORACLE instance (normal)ITPUB个人空间/s&rU&IK N*P*|s
LICENSE_MAX_SESSION = 0ITPUB个人空间*TWT2@9\XLA{9J
LICENSE_SESSIONS_WARNING = 0
0W2Z[9CuQX0SCN scheme 3
)c}8o!R;\}0Using log_archive_dest parameter default valueITPUB个人空间0F\;p"e2K5r
LICENSE_MAX_USERS = 0ITPUB个人空间p+z9]4]'XTd XJ
SYS auditing is disabledITPUB个人空间5lu'E(W AH\g ^
Starting up ORACLE RDBMS Version:9.2.0.4.0.
Y"XCa&s1bVA0System parameters with non-default values:
`irN6H0  processes                = 150
K~/C;k(\"^7J0  timed_statistics         = TRUEITPUB个人空间2xm$z&r Bx
  shared_pool_size         = 117440512ITPUB个人空间a7D)Fvg*\qB%t
  large_pool_size          = 16777216
U$A?tB i2_G]0  java_pool_size           = 117440512ITPUB个人空间,AK [:Y"l0F
  control_files            = /u1/oracle/oradata/repdb01/control01.ctl, /u1/oracle/oradata/repdb01/control02.ctl, /u1/oracle/oradata/ITPUB个人空间NG6A;Wa
repdb01/control03.ctlITPUB个人空间#ohp s*M
  db_block_size            = 8192
e-} R$qw-l$T+m%}0  db_cache_size            = 16777216ITPUB个人空间(I&IG3m Q#k#c l6|)K[
  compatible               = 9.2.0.0.0
mF2b$B&MGK0  db_file_multiblock_read_count= 32ITPUB个人空间8]-{,@q f
  fast_start_mttr_target   = 300
xy~/f)luPrH J6F0  undo_management          = AUTOITPUB个人空间n x?/~ck#a"P"l
  undo_tablespace          = UNDOTBS1ITPUB个人空间|orN1i!y2R
  undo_retention           = 10800
8ru8Aec#?0  remote_login_passwordfile= EXCLUSIVEITPUB个人空间FQ;o$H:^F-sd
  db_domain                =ITPUB个人空间z/Qw9u8h9Z1X)P
  instance_name            = repdb01
h2`$m2\5vkZ0  dispatchers              = (PROTOCOL=TCP) (SERVICE=repdb01XDB)
1I G PZM;U0  job_queue_processes      = 10ITPUB个人空间#l8c'{Z[Vr;t v4Dc@n
  hash_join_enabled        = TRUE
s p%f'G!E;y-_0  hash_area_size           = 1048576
3y(s |(Lj0  background_dump_dest     = /u1/oracle/admin/repdb01/bdump
8} v `9Fh2Ky A4{0  user_dump_dest           = /u1/oracle/admin/repdb01/udumpITPUB个人空间|W |$R%l
  core_dump_dest           = /u1/oracle/admin/repdb01/cdumpITPUB个人空间J.HZ;EB9M9@[~
  sort_area_size           = 10485760ITPUB个人空间FD+q~WN9Dw+Xm
  db_name                  = repdb01ITPUB个人空间Bjj#N3w.y;Bc
  open_cursors             = 300ITPUB个人空间5?6^TRIA*Z
  star_transformation_enabled= TRUE
hq O S2E%x0  query_rewrite_enabled    = TRUEITPUB个人空间2Jz&D F6N5qASH
  pga_aggregate_target     = 33554432
.y:I IM h0  aq_tm_processes          = 1
V\D/` O0PMON started with pid=2
nId @kUc0DBW0 started with pid=3ITPUB个人空间qo8J5F-[)rzZ
LGWR started with pid=4
(I O`h9]8L"Oq5fA0CKPT started with pid=5ITPUB个人空间fEJ9t6TF
SMON started with pid=6
| ve:g/y*]0RECO started with pid=7ITPUB个人空间:W(\9p+B%i;j3],Y
CJQ0 started with pid=8
i8Bc3TY"F8?0QMN0 started with pid=9ITPUB个人空间9@8oG:e}N%g w
Sun Aug  8 09:40:50 2004
I S_:d ir0starting up 1 shared server(s) ...
+E)ZP[%H/B$s0Sun Aug  8 09:40:50 2004
Y!sr;UW Us$c[s0starting up 1 dispatcher(s) for network address '(ADDRESS=(PARTIAL=YES)(PROTOCOL=TCP))'...ITPUB个人空间 MSx!Q b_
Sun Aug  8 09:40:50 2004
7bK1Eoh;IL0ALTER DATABASE   MOUNTITPUB个人空间3Udy [q+nk
Sun Aug  8 09:40:57 2004ITPUB个人空间)H~~~ A?N%UK1J
Successful mount of redo thread 1, with mount id 2657795813.
gP?\S&IZ0Vw0Sun Aug  8 09:40:57 2004ITPUB个人空间 @\ @8Yw#Z$b
Database mounted in Exclusive Mode.
vi n B+S0w#Mt0Completed: ALTER DATABASE   MOUNTITPUB个人空间&m*_-V U4@n3kY*X `:}
Sun Aug  8 09:40:57 2004
%GKAw)w0ALTER DATABASE OPEN

由于整个信息处于alert文件的开头位置,从这个信息上看,应该是处于从模板中创建数据库的过程。观察随后的启动信息,数据库软件应该已经升级到了9204版本。

下面看看trace文件中摘录的信息:

*** 2004-08-08 09:40:36.314ITPUB个人空间h SciW'ay
ksedmp: internal or fatal error
k^8t5~@ k0ORA-00600: internal error code, arguments: [qmxiUnpPacked2], [121], [], [], [], [], [], []ITPUB个人空间/x2]/hy?,Fi"g
Current SQL statement for this session:
{wj _1L L0select 1ITPUB个人空间'UeGe HE
      from resource_view
V/^iE%f)D0      where any_path = '/xdbconfig.xml'ITPUB个人空间b/@#_I!G$np
----- PL/SQL Call Stack -----ITPUB个人空间3Jy1I-P2?&y
  object      line  object
H-H4ol2[ Gb*L(_0  handle    number  name
1iN1FK5Tzrv038e5b9500         6  package body XDB.DBMS_REGXDBITPUB个人空间BH PH \$~E
38e5c3eb8         1  anonymous blockITPUB个人空间1eUi!J4H#Py+mh
38e688990       639  package body SYS.DBMS_REGISTRY
_%~|gRlW_I0ID038ee5d410         1  anonymous block

从上面的这些信息不难判断,在通过模板生成数据库的XDB阶段发生了问题。

根据这些信息查询metalink,发现和Bug No. 2508631的描述最为接近。不但问题也是发生在通过模板建立数据库的过程中,而且操作系统也同样是Solaris系统。而且导致问题产生的SQL语句也是完全一样的。

不过这个bug并非基础bug,它指向Bug No. 2734234,而后指向Bug No. 2744295,最终指向Bug No. 3003273

这个错误并不会在DBCA界面上提示任何的错误,对数据库也不会产生什么危害。

 


TAG:

 

评分:0

我来说两句

显示全部

:loveliness: :handshake :victory: :funk: :time: :kiss: :call: :hug: :lol :'( :Q :L ;P :$ :P :o :@ :D :( :)

Open Toolbar